Over the past decade, the Marietta Police Department has faced several disciplinary actions involving its officers. Notable incidents include cases of racially insensitive behavior and domestic violence. The department has implemented policies such as use-of-force guidelines emphasizing de-escalation, body-worn camera requirements, and regular training on topics like implicit bias and cultural sensitivity. Complaints are investigated by the Internal Affairs Division, with disciplinary actions ranging from reprimands to termination. The department also engages in community outreach and maintains transparency to build public trust.
